In what specific way did Phoenician writing differ from cuneiform?

Phoenician writing was an alphabetic script, with one symbol representing one sound, while cuneiform was a complex script with many signs representing syllables, Words, or concepts. Phoenician writing was more flexible and easier to learn compared to cuneiform.
